The author focuses on research into the role that well-educated elites played in enabling technological and scientific creativity during the Industrial Revolution of the late 18th century. He mentions a paper by M. P. Squicciarini and N. Voigtlander examining the number of people who subscribed to the "Grande Encyclopédie" published in 1777-1778 and economic development in French cities where subscribers lived. He commented on the role of elites in the early stages of industrialization.
